Police arrested a 46-year-old man and a 35-year-old man on Monday after discovering a large cache of firearms and explosives in an Orokolini cemetery. According to a police statement, the raid was conducted by drug squad (Ykan) officers around noon.
Police observed two individuals behaving suspiciously as they approached the cemetery in Larnaca province with their vehicles. One person acted as a lookout while the other exited his vehicle, entered the cemetery, and approached a specific grave where he retrieved a large bag.
Upon stopping the suspect, police found 10 boxes of pistol bullets, various cartridges, a pistol, and a hunting rifle. Further investigations by the police uncovered a military rifle, an anti-tank gun, two missiles, three missile launchers, a package of cartridges, an improvised explosive device containing high-powered explosives, a quantity of high explosives, a pistol, and two silencers hidden in the grave.
Reports indicate that the 46-year-old suspect worked at a local funeral home and had previously been observed engaging in suspicious activities in the cemetery. The second suspect, aged 35, was also taken into custody.
Police are investigating whether the items were intended for criminal use.
